Get the Threats and Countermeasures and the XP security guides,
from MS, which you should be able to find with searches, and
checkout the discussions you can locate in these with find.
You will notice it is all relative to the nature of use of the XP.
In a stand-alone there is no real need for either, but RPC does
need to be installed if you want all things to work (it does not
however need to be bound to a nic).
